Photographs, 1893-ca. 1900-1901
Scope and Contents
Series I comprises one hundred and fifty-nine photographic prints, all but three in 6 ¼” x 8 ¼” format. These cover images of Russia, Siberia, China, Turkestan, Mongolia, and Manchuria from the early years of the 1900s. All of these have printed labels affixed to the backs carrying a unique 4-digit number, a place name, short caption, and the credit line “Records of the Past Exploration Society, 215 3rd Ave., Washington, D.C.” Two prints taken in Russia and Manchuria are in different papers and sizes, and do not have the printed labels; inscriptions in ink appear on the backs identifying their subjects. A cabinet card portrait of Frederick Bennett Wright taken in 1893 by a Cleveland photographer is included in the series.
